Modul:BanánokArgumentumok/tesztdoboz

A Wikipédiából, a szabad enciklopédiából

BanánokArgumentumok/tesztdoboz[mi ez?] • [dokumentáció: mutat, szerkeszt] • [tesztek: létrehozás]

-- Unit tesztje a [[Modul:BanánokArgumentumok]] modulnak. Kattints a vitalapjára és fut a teszt.
local p = require('Modul:UnitTesztek')
 
function p:test_hello_vilag()
    self:preprocess_equals('{{#invoke:BanánokArgumentumok|hello_vilag}}', 'Hello, világ!')
end
 
function p:test_add()
    self:preprocess_equals('{{#invoke:BanánokArgumentumok|add|5|3}}', '8')
end
 
function p:test_gyumolcsszamlalas()
    self:preprocess_equals('{{#invoke:BanánokArgumentumok|gyumolcsszamlalas|banánból=5|almából=3}}','Van 5 banánom és 3 almám')
end
 
function p:test_gyumolcsei()
    self:preprocess_equals('{{#invoke:BanánokArgumentumok|gyumolcsei|Feri|banánból=5|cseresznyéből=7}}','Ferinek van: 5 banánja 7 cseresznyéje')
end
 
function p:test_gyumolcsok_fogyasztasa()
    self:preprocess_equals('{{#invoke:BanánokArgumentumok|gyumolcsok_fogyasztasa|szilva=10|kivi=5}}', 'Amim van az: 10 szilva 5 kivi')
end
 
function p:test_gyumolcsok_fogyasztasa_2()
    self:preprocess_equals('{{#invoke:BanánokArgumentumok|gyumolcsok_fogyasztasa_2|Feri|szilva=10|kivi=5}}', 'Feri gyümölcsei: 10 szilva 5 kivi')
end
 
return p